TO THE MEN OF THE CLASS OF 1957: May I take advantage of the opportunity which the publication of this Year Book presents to express my thanks and appre. iation to the members of the Class of 1957 for their service to the school and their cooperation in every worth-while school effort this year. As you know, here at The English High School, it has become traditional for the faculty and the student body to look to the members of the Senior Class for leadership in every activity, — scholastic or otherwise. May I, therefore, congratulate the Class of 1957 for its year of successful achieve¬ ment and service to our school. It has provided splendid leadership, fostered worth¬ while ideals and attitudes, and maintained a high level of scholastic achievement. I know that the years just past will prove helpful to you in the years to come. May I express the wish that each of you may realize his own best development in the years that lie ahead, and achieve the aim of every English High School student, which is to BECOME A MAN OF HONOR AND ACHIEVEMENT through service to mankind. May God bless your every effort. Joseph L. Malone Head Master

The Class of 1957 congratulates The Headmaster . . . Joseph L. Malone . . . Upon the assumption of his duty as Head Master of The English High School. As a former member of the faculty he will bring a thorough understanding of the school and its purpose. We leave the future of the school to him and its faculty with complete confidence and warm appreciation.

Zhe President’s Message As I bid farewell to the class of 1957 at English High, I do so with sadness. These years have been the happiest of my life. Here I have found the finest in Ameri¬ can traditions. We all shall leave this school with feelings of pride, of gratitude and of assurance. We have the right to believe that we are graduates of the finest school in America. To my classmates, I extend the wish that the future will hold not only physical but spiritual blessings as well. We have been extremely fortunate in having a faculty which not only tried to prepare us to meet the edu¬ cational standards required of a high school graduate but they have also endeavored to give us the knowledge we shall need to mingle and live harmoniously with our fellow man. Long after our high school days are over, the advice we have received will come back to us, to guide us in the years to come. Robert LeBlanc Senior Class Officers Left to right — Anthony J. Iasbarrone, Executive Committee; Michael F. Sammarco, Vice-President; Robert P. Le Blanc, President; Francis E. Paris, Secretary-Treasurer; Vincent S. Ceglie, Executive Committee.
